Cervera defends investment in beds to isolate the elderly in the midst of a pandemic

The ‘counselor’ of Social Rights of the GeneralitatViolant Cervera, has defended this Wednesday the investment of the Government to guarantee that in the Catalan residences would have free beds to isolate elderly people with covid in the midst of a pandemic, when there were still no vaccines against the coronavirus.

He said it in one interpellation of the deputy of Cs, Anna Grau, in the Parliament, which has asked him about the 7.8 million that the Generalitat paid to centers to reserve spaces for residents with covid that were not occupied, according to EL PERIÓDICO.

“Has there been or is there 3% in white coats?” asked Grau, who has asked more transparency and control to the Government in social and health tenders and eradicate malpractice in this area.

Isolation, the only option

Cervera has maintained that the Government adopted a decree law that reserved places to isolate the elderly after Parliament passed a resolution calling for guarantee “isolation spaces” in residential centers in a monographic plenary session in July 2020.

He remembered that at that time the isolation was the only measure to prevent covid infectionssince there were no vaccines available yet, and that later the Parliament validated the decree: “Apologize, whatever is necessary, because that was terrible for many citizens.”

“But you also have to remember how terrible that time was, the misinformation and inability of all health authorities to combat it. The only tool found then was the isolates“, has added.
